Tig is a stunning one-year-old brown tabby with gorgeous hints of warm orange woven through her long-haired coat.

This sweet girl has had a rough go of it. After being bullied by another cat in her previous home, Tig needs a calm, peaceful environment where she can truly exhale and be herself. Once she feels safe she absolutely blossoms into a little cuddle bug soaking up every pet and snuggle like it's her full-time job.

Tig is looking for a quiet home where she can be the one and only — no competition, no anxiety, just patience and pure devoted companionship. In return, she'll give you her whole heart.

All of our cats come spayed or neutered, microchipped, and with age-appropriate vaccinations. Young cats have an adoption fee of $175. Alternative Humane Society of Whatcom County's Adoption Policy
AHS does not do same-day adoptions. We provide a form called a “Statement of Interest” for potential adopters to fill out. When completed, this form is reviewed by an AHS volunteer (the animal’s Case Manager) who will contact any potential adopter with any additional questions and arrange a meeting if it looks like a good match. The potential adopter usually hears back from a volunteer within 1-2 weeks. The case manager will only be contacting SOI that our might be a good fit and will arrange a meet and greet. Adoption fees for DOGS are: Puppies (up to age 18 months): $425 (plus $200spay/neuter deposit for puppies that are not spayed or neutered at time of adoption)Cash only Adults (18 months - 8 years old): $350 Seniors (8 years and up): $225 Adoption fees for CATS are: Kittens (up to 6 months): $200 Young Adult cats (7 months -3 years) $175 Adult cats (4-7 years): $150 Senior Cats (8+ years) $100 Adoption fees include: Basic shots, spay/neuter, and microchip on dogs and cats (except puppies under 6 months of age). All cats are FIV/FELV tested.
